Sistemes de disseny Utility First: Guia estratègica

Els sistemes de disseny utility first revolucionen l'eficiència del desenvolupament, amb un 73% dels equips que reporten velocitats d'implementació més ràpides i una reducció del 68% en la sobrecarga de manteniment de CSS en comparació amb els enfocaments tradicionals basats en components. La planificació estratègica per a metodologies utility-first permet fluxos de treball de desenvolupament escalables que mantenen la consistència alhora que s'adapten al desenvolupament ràpid de funcions i a l'evolució del disseny.
Construir sistemes de disseny consistents utilitzant la metodologia CSS utility-first requereix un enfocament sistemàtic que equilibri la flexibilitat amb la mantenibilitat. Estratègies de desenvolupament utility first professionals aconsegueixen un 89% de reutilització de codi alhora que redueixen el temps de traspàs de disseny a desenvolupament en un 54% mitjançant patrons d'utilitat estandarditzats i una planificació d'arquitectura escalable.
Base estratègica per a l'arquitectura Utility-First
La planificació utility-first estratègica estableix un marc integral per al desenvolupament escalable que s'adapta al creixement empresarial alhora que manté la consistència del disseny i la velocitat del desenvolupament. Els enfocaments CSS sistemàtics redueixen el deute tècnic en un 67% alhora que permeten la creació ràpida de prototips i el desenvolupament de funcions a través de diversos requisits de projecte.
La integració de tokens de disseny forma la base dels sistemes de disseny utility-first eficaços, proporcionant valors consistents que s'escalen entre components i plataformes. Estratègies de tokens de disseny professionals milloren l'alineació disseny-desenvolupament en un 61% alhora que redueixen les inconsistències que normalment afecten el 43% de les implementacions CSS tradicionals.
- Categorització d'utilitats organitzant utilitats funcionals per propòsit i complexitat per a la implementació sistemàtica
- Estandardització de la convenció de nomenclatura establint patrons consistents que s'escalen entre equips i projectes
- Integració de l'estratègia de resposta planificant sistemes de punts de trencada que funcionen perfectament amb patrons d'utilitat
- Definició dels límits dels components determinació de l'equilibri òptim entre utilitats i components compostos
- Planificació de l'optimització del rendiment assegurant que els sistemes d'utilitat mantinguin l'eficiència a escala
La metodologia CSS escalable permet als equips construir interfícies complexes alhora que mantenen la velocitat del desenvolupament i la qualitat del codi. La planificació de la metodologia estratègica redueix el temps d'incorporació per als nous desenvolupadors en un 52% alhora que garanteix patrons d'implementació consistents entre els membres de l'equip i les fases del projecte.
Implementació de patrons d'utilitat sistemàtics
La implementació sistemàtica del patró d'utilitat requereix una planificació integral que abordi el disseny, l'espaiat, la tipografia i els patrons d'interacció a través de classes atòmiques reutilitzables. El desenvolupament utility first professional aconsegueix una reutilització del patró del 94% alhora que manté la flexibilitat del disseny i la composició dels components en diversos requisits d'interfície.
Els sistemes d'utilitat de disseny proporcionen una base flexible per a disposicions d'interfície complexes alhora que mantenen la consistència i el comportament adaptable. La planificació estratègica del disseny redueix el temps d'implementació de la graella en un 78% mitjançant patrons d'utilitat sistemàtics que s'adapten a diversos tipus de contingut i models d'interacció.
Quan s'implementen sistemes de graella complexes dins de marcs utility-first, plataformes de generació de graelles utility professionals automatitzen la creació d'utilitats de graella consistents i escalables que s'integren perfectament amb els patrons d'utilitat existents, reduint el desenvolupament manual de la graella de 6+ hores a menys de 15 minuts alhora que garanteixen la compatibilitat del marc.
Categoria d'utilitats | Prioritat d'implementació | Impacte en el desenvolupament | Sobrecàrrega de manteniment | Factor d'escalabilitat |
---|---|---|---|---|
Disseny i graella | Molt alt | Alt | Baix | Excel·lent |
Espaiat i dimensions | Molt alt | Molt alt | Molt baix | Excel·lent |
Tipografia | Alt | Alt | Baix | Bona |
Color i temes | Alt | Mitjà | Mitjà | Bona |
Estats interactius | Mitjà | Mitjà | Baix | Bona |
Animació i efectes | Baix | Baix | Mitjà | Acceptable |
Les utilitats d'espaiat i de dimensions creen un ritme i una proporció constants a través dels elements de la interfície alhora que permeten composicions de disseny flexibles. La implementació sistemàtica de l'espaiat millora la consistència visual en un 71% alhora que redueix la fatiga de la presa de decisions de disseny que afecta el 38% dels equips de desenvolupament que utilitzen enfocaments d'espaiat ad hoc.
Integració i adopció del flux de treball de l'equip
L'adopció reeixida del sistema de disseny utility first requereix una integració estratègica de l'equip que abordi els canvis en el flux de treball, les corbes d'aprenentatge i els patrons de col·laboració entre els equips de disseny i desenvolupament. Estratègies d'adopció professionals aconsegueixen el compliment de l'equip en un 87% en 6 setmanes alhora que mantenen la productivitat durant els períodes de transició.
La formació i la documentació permeten una transició fluida de l'equip alhora que eviten inconsistències d'implementació que poden minar l'eficàcia del sistema de disseny utility first. Els programes de formació integrals redueixen l'impacte de la corba d'aprenentatge en un 64% alhora que garanteixen una aplicació consistent de les utilitats entre els membres de l'equip i les fases del projecte.
L'optimització de la passada de disseny a desenvolupament racionalitza la col·laboració a través de processos de disseny conscients de les utilitats i un vocabulari compartit. La millora estratègica de la passada redueix els desacords d'implementació en un 58% alhora que accelera la lliurament de funcions mitjançant una millor comunicació i una comprensió compartida dels patrons d'utilitat.
- Desenvolupament del currículum d'incorporació creació de vies d'aprenentatge sistemàtiques per a l'adopció de la metodologia utility-first
- Integració d'eines de disseny connexió dels sistemes de disseny amb marcs d'utilitat per a un flux de treball consistent
- Estandardització de la revisió de codi establir criteris de revisió específics de les utilitats i directrius de qualitat
- Configuració del seguiment del rendiment seguiment de l'impacte del sistema d'utilitat en la velocitat de desenvolupament i la qualitat del codi
- Establiment de bucles de retroalimentació habilitació de la millora contínua dels patrons d'utilitat i els processos de l'equip
Estratègies de migració graduals permeten als equips adoptar enfocaments utility-first sense interrompre els projectes en curs ni la productivitat. La planificació de la migració professional aconsegueix una transició sense problemes per al 91% dels equips alhora que manté la qualitat del codi i els calendaris de lliurament durant els períodes d'adopció.
Planificació d'escalabilitat per a aplicacions empresarials
Els sistemes de disseny utility first a escala empresarial requereixen una planificació sofisticada que abordi el rendiment, la mantenibilitat i la governança a través d'organitzacions de desenvolupament importants. La planificació d'escalabilitat estratègica permet una implementació consistent a través de 50+ equips de desenvolupadors alhora que manté els estàndards de rendiment i qualitat del codi a través d'estratègies de governança i optimització sistemàtiques.
L'optimització del rendiment a escala garanteix que els sistemes d'utilitat mantinguin l'eficiència alhora que donen suport a aplicacions empresarials complexes i escenaris d'alt trànsit. L'optimització professional del rendiment aconsegueix reduccions de la mida del paquet del 43% alhora que manté la funcionalitat completa de l'utilitat mitjançant l'optimització estratègica i els enfocaments de càrrega condicional.
L'establiment d'un marc de governança proporciona supervisió i estàndards que mantenen la qualitat del sistema d'utilitat alhora que permeten el desenvolupament distribuït a través de múltiples equips i projectes. La governança estratègica redueix les inconsistències d'utilitat en un 76% alhora que permet la innovació i l'adaptació en un marc establert.
- Estratègies de control de versions gestió de l'evolució del sistema d'utilitats a través de múltiples projectes i equips
- Protocols de canvis que interrompen implementació d'actualitzacions controlades que minimitzen les interrupcions en el desenvolupament en curs
- Automatització de l'assegurança de la qualitat assegurant que les implementacions d'utilitats compleixin els estàndards de rendiment i consistència
- Manteniment de la documentació mantenint les biblioteques d'utilitats actualitzades i accessibles a través d'organitzacions empresarials
- Coordinació intergrups facilitació de la col·laboració i el compartiment del coneixement entre equips de desenvolupament distribuïts
La coordinació de múltiples projectes permet als sistemes de disseny utility first escalar entre diverses aplicacions alhora que manté la consistència i els beneficis compartits. Les estratègies de coordinació professionals aconsegueixen una reutilització del codi del 75% entre projectes alhora que permeten la personalització específica de l'aplicació i els requisits d'optimització.
Integració i temes de tokens de disseny
La integració del token de disseny crea una base sistemàtica per als sistemes de disseny utility first que permet una temàtica consistent, l'adaptació de la marca i el desplegament entre plataformes. La planificació estratègica dels tokens millora la consistència del disseny en un 79% alhora que permet un desenvolupament ràpid de temes i una personalització de la marca entre diversos contextos d'aplicació.
La planificació de la jerarquia dels tokens estableix una organització lògica que s'escala des de valors atòmics fins a tokens semàntics complexos que donen suport a diversos casos d'ús. L'arquitectura de tokens professional redueix el temps de desenvolupament del tema en un 61% alhora que garanteix una aplicació consistent de les directrius de marca a través de les implementacions d'utilitat.
Les estratègies de tokens de múltiples plataformes permeten que els sistemes de disseny utility first donin suport a aplicacions web, mòbils i d'escriptori mitjançant un llenguatge de disseny compartit i patrons d'implementació consistents. La planificació estratègica entre plataformes aconsegueix una consistència de disseny del 88% entre plataformes alhora que manté l'optimització específica de la plataforma i els requisits de l'experiència d'usuari.
Categoria de tokens | Nivell d'abstracció | Freqüència d'actualització | Abast de l'impacte | Nivell de governança |
---|---|---|---|---|
Valors primitius | Baix | Rar | A tot el sistema | Alt |
Colors semàntics | Mitjà | Ocasional | A nivell de component | Mitjà |
Tokens de components | Alt | Regular | Específic de la funció | Baix |
Tokens de disseny | Mitjà | Rar | A tot el sistema | Alt |
Tokens tipogràfics | Mitjà | Ocasional | Centrat en el contingut | Mitjà |
Tokens d'animació | Alt | Regular | Específic de la interacció | Baix |
Quan s'implementen sistemes de tokens integrals que integren marcs utility-first, plataformes de generació d'utilitats conscients dels tokens incorporen automàticament els tokens de disseny en la generació d'utilitats, assegurant que els sistemes de graella reflecteixin les directrius actuals de la marca alhora que mantinguin la consistència sistemàtica entre les actualitzacions dels tokens i les variacions del tema.
Optimització del rendiment i gestió de paquets
L'optimització del rendiment garanteix que els sistemes de disseny utility first mantinguin l'eficiència alhora que ofereixen funcionalitat i flexibilitat exhaustives. La planificació estratègica del rendiment aconsegueix reduccions de la mida del paquet del 56% mitjançant l'organització intel·ligent de les utilitats, l'optimització de la poda d'arbres i les estratègies de càrrega condicional que preserven la funcionalitat alhora que milloren el rendiment de la càrrega.
Estratègies d'optimització de la compilació permeten paquets de producció eficients que inclouen només les utilitats necessàries alhora que mantenen la flexibilitat del desenvolupament i la cobertura integral de les utilitats. L'optimització professional de la compilació redueix el CSS de producció en un 67% alhora que preserva la funcionalitat completa de les utilitats mitjançant processos d'optimització i compilació intel·ligents.
Configuració de la poda d'arbres elimina les utilitats no utilitzades de les compilacions de producció alhora que preserva l'experiència de desenvolupament i la cobertura integral de les utilitats. La poda d'arbres estratègica millora el rendiment de la càrrega en un 41% mitjançant l'anàlisi de dependències intel·ligent i la inclusió selectiva d'utilitats basada en patrons d'ús reals.
- Identificació d'utilitats crítiques determinació de les utilitats essencials per a la renderització per sobre del plec i les interaccions inicials
- Estratègies de càrrega lenta implementació de la càrrega progressiva d'utilitats per a components d'interfície no crítics
- Optimització de la divisió de paquets organització de les utilitats per a l'emmagatzemament en memòria cau eficient i les estratègies de càrrega incremental
- Configuració de la compressió aplicació de tècniques de compressió avançades al CSS de les utilitats per a una eficiència de transferència òptima
- Seguiment del rendiment seguiment de l'impacte del sistema d'utilitats en els temps de càrrega i les mètriques de l'experiència de l'usuari
L'optimització del rendiment en temps d'execució garanteix que les aplicacions d'utilitats mantinguin interaccions suaus i un comportament receptiu entre les diferents capacitats dels dispositius i les condicions de la xarxa. L'optimització professional en temps d'execució aconsegueix millores en la receptivitat de les interaccions del 34% alhora que manté la funcionalitat de les utilitats i les normes de qualitat visual.
Estratègies d'assegurança i proves de qualitat
L'assegurança de la qualitat exhaustiva garanteix que els sistemes de disseny utility first mantinguin la consistència, el rendiment i la funcionalitat entre els escenaris d'implementació i els patrons d'ús de l'equip. La planificació estratègica de l'QA identifica el 93% de problemes d'utilitat abans del desplegament a la producció alhora que manté la velocitat del desenvolupament a través de les proves i els processos de validació automatitzats.
Les proves de regressió visual identifiquen inconsistències en la implementació de les utilitats i canvis no desitjats que podrien afectar l'experiència de l'usuari i la consistència de la marca. Les proves visuals professionals prevenen el 78% de les inconsistències visuals alhora que permeten actualitzacions i evolucions del sistema amb confiança sense trencar les implementacions existents.
La comprovació automatitzada de la consistència valida les aplicacions d'utilitats enfront dels estàndards del sistema de disseny i els requisits de rendiment mitjançant l'anàlisi i l'informe sistemàtics. L'automatització estratègica redueix la sobrecarga de l'QA manual en un 69% alhora que millora la precisió de la detecció de la consistència i permet el seguiment continu de la qualitat.
- Auditoria de l'ús d'utilitats rastrejar els patrons d'aplicació d'utilitats per identificar oportunitats d'optimització i tendències d'ús
- Compatibilitat entre navegadors assegurant que les implementacions d'utilitats funcionin de manera consistent entre els entorns i les versions del navegador
- Detecció de regressió del rendiment supervisar l'impacte del sistema d'utilitat en el rendiment durant les actualitzacions i les modificacions
- Compliment de l'accessibilitat assegurar que les aplicacions d'utilitat compleixin els estàndards d'accessibilitat i els requisits de disseny inclusiu
- Proves d'integració de components assegurant que les utilitats funcionin correctament dins dels contextos i els escenaris d'interacció dels components
Per a proves exhaustives de sistemes d'utilitat complexos amb implementacions de graella sofisticades, plataformes de generació d'utilitats integrades per a l'QA inclouen proves i validació integrades que garanteixen que les utilitats generades compleixin els estàndards de qualitat automàticament, eliminant la sobrecarga de proves manuals que normalment requereix 20+ hores per actualització del sistema d'utilitats.
Mesura de l'èxit i millora contínua
Els sistemes de mesura estratègics rastregen l'eficàcia del sistema de disseny utility first mitjançant mètriques quantificables que s'alineen amb els objectius empresarials i els objectius de desenvolupament. Els enfocaments de mesura professionals demostren millores del ROI de 3,8x en 12 mesos alhora que permeten l'optimització basada en dades i l'evolució contínua del sistema.
El seguiment de la velocitat del desenvolupament quantifica l'impacte del sistema d'utilitat en la velocitat de lliurament de funcions i la productivitat de l'equip alhora que identifica oportunitats d'optimització. La mesura estratègica de la velocitat mostra una acceleració mitjana del desenvolupament del 47% alhora que manté la qualitat del codi i la consistència del disseny.
Mètrica d'èxit | Mètode de mesura | Millora prevista | Impacte en el negoci | Freqüència de supervisió |
---|---|---|---|---|
Velocitat de desenvolupament | Seguiment del lliurament de funcions | Un 40% més ràpid | Reducció de costos | Setmanal |
Consistència del codi | Anàlisi automatitzada | Un 85% de compliment | Fortalesa de la marca | Diari |
Mida del paquet | Supervisió de la compilació | Una reducció del 50% | Millor rendiment | Per compilació |
Adopció de l'equip | Anàlisi d'ús | Una adopció del 90% | Eficiència del flux de treball | Mensual |
Sobrecàrrega de manteniment | Seguiment del temps | Una reducció del 60% | Optimització de recursos | Mensual |
Precisió del disseny | Comparació visual | Una fidelitat del 95% | Experiència de l'usuari | Per llançament |
Els processos de millora contínua permeten que els sistemes de disseny utility first evolucionin amb els requisits canviants alhora que mantenen l'eficàcia i l'adopció de l'equip. La planificació estratègica de la millora aconsegueix guanyes de rendiment sostenibles mitjançant cicles d'optimització sistemàtics i una adaptació receptiva als comentaris de l'equip i els patrons d'ús.
La integració de comentaris permet una evolució receptiva del sistema d'utilitats que aborda els patrons d'ús reals i les necessitats de l'equip alhora que manté la direcció estratègica i la sostenibilitat a llarg termini. Els sistemes de comentaris professionals milloren la rellevància de les utilitats en un 72% alhora que eviten la inflació del sistema i mantenint l'enfocament en la funcionalitat d'alt impacte.
Dominar els sistemes de disseny utility first requereix una planificació estratègica que abasta l'arquitectura, l'adopció de l'equip, l'escalabilitat i l'optimització contínua per a una eficiència de desenvolupament sostenible. Comença amb una anàlisi exhaustiva dels patrons d'utilitat i una planificació sistemàtica de la implementació, estableix fluxos de treball de l'equip que donin suport a l'adopció i la consistència i implementa sistemes de mesura que demostrin valor alhora que guiïn l'optimització contínua. La inversió utility-first estratègica ofereix millores immediates de la productivitat alhora que construeix una infraestructura de desenvolupament que s'escala de manera eficaç amb el creixement de l'equip i la complexitat del projecte. Els sistemes utility professionals permeten als equips centrar-se en la innovació i l'experiència de l'usuari en lloc de reptes d'estil repetitius alhora que mantenen la qualitat del disseny i la consistència de la marca entre diversos contextos d'aplicació i requisits empresarials.